Our Access Control Solutions
Keyless Entry Systems
Embrace the convenience and security of keyless entry. We offer advanced systems that utilize keypads, proximity cards, fobs, or even smartphone apps for entry. Imagine never having to worry about lost keys again, or being able to grant temporary access to guests or service providers remotely. These systems are ideal for residential properties in areas like Laurel, Fullerton, and small businesses seeking a modern, streamlined entry solution.
Proximity Card and Fob Systems
A popular choice for businesses and apartment buildings, proximity card and fob systems provide a secure and easily manageable way to control access. Each card or fob can be programmed with specific access privileges, allowing you to grant or revoke entry instantly. This is particularly beneficial for managing employee access to different zones within a building or for residents in multi-unit dwellings across Fullerton’s various ZIP codes.
Biometric Access Control
For the highest level of security, biometric systems use unique physical characteristics like fingerprints or facial recognition. These systems offer virtually unalterable identification, making them ideal for sensitive areas or high-security facilities. If you operate a business with valuable assets or require stringent security protocols in areas like the Orange County Great Park vicinity (though technically Irvine, the influence extends), biometric solutions offer superior protection.
Smart Locks and Mobile Access
Modernizing your home or business in Fullerton has never been easier. Smart locks integrate with your Wi-Fi or Bluetooth, allowing you to control access via a smartphone app. Grant entry remotely, monitor who comes and goes, and receive alerts β all from your mobile device. This is perfect for homeowners in neighborhoods like Canyon Crest or property managers overseeing rentals near Fullerton College.
Networked Access Control Systems
For larger commercial buildings or multi-site operations, networked access control systems provide centralized management and real-time monitoring. These robust systems allow administrators to control access permissions across multiple doors and locations from a single interface, track entry and exit logs, and integrate with other security systems. 2. Power Outages and Connectivity Issues
Problem: While generally reliable, power outages can occur in Fullerton, impacting electronic access control systems. In older buildings or areas with less robust infrastructure, intermittent Wi-Fi or network connectivity can also disrupt the functionality of smart locks and networked systems.
Solution: We integrate battery backup systems and uninterruptible power supplies (UPS) for critical access points. For networked systems, we can implement fail-safe or fail-secure modes that ensure doors remain locked or unlocked during power loss, depending on the security requirement. We also advise on and install robust network infrastructure solutions to minimize connectivity interruptions.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the typical lifespan of an access control system?
The lifespan of an access control system can vary significantly depending on the quality of the components, the environment they are installed in, and the level of maintenance they receive. Generally, the electronic components like control panels and readers can last anywhere from 5 to 15 years. However, software platforms are often updated, and newer technologies emerge more frequently. Regular maintenance, as recommended by Top Locksmith CA, can extend the functional life of your hardware and ensure optimal performance.
Can I integrate an access control system with my existing security cameras?
Yes, in most cases. Many modern access control systems are designed to integrate with other security infrastructure, including CCTV or alarm systems. This integration can allow for enhanced monitoring, such as triggering camera recording when a specific access event occurs or linking access logs with video footage. What happens if the power goes out? Will I be locked out?
This is a common concern, and a well-designed access control system will have safeguards against power outages. Most systems can be equipped with battery backups or connect to an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S). Depending on the system’s configuration, it can be set to fail-safe (unlocking doors during an outage for emergency egress) or fail-secure (keeping doors locked for continued security). We ensure your system is configured appropriately for your needs.
How do I grant or revoke access for someone with a smart lock system?
With smart lock systems managed through a mobile app or web portal, granting or revoking access is typically very simple and can be done remotely. You can usually create temporary access codes for guests or service providers that expire automatically, or grant permanent access to family members or employees. Revoking access is just as easy and takes effect immediately, ensuring your property remains secure.
